Southend's books of condolence in memory of Queen Elizabeth II are set to close today.
Today (September 20) is the last day that Southend Council's books of condolence will be open for messages in memory of the late Queen.
Books of condolence will be open at the Civic Centre, Shoebury Library and Leigh Community Centre until 5pm.
Floral tributes can be also be left at the fountain outside the Civic Centre or Leigh Library Gardens.
However, the council asks residents who decide to leave flowers to remove the cellophane wrapping to protect the environment.
The online royal book of condolence is also available for anyone to send a message of condolence to the royal family.
A selection of messages will be passed onto members of the royal family, and may be held in the Royal Archives for posterity.
Members of the public can send their message of condolence using the form at royal.uk.
